Hi all,

 

Can anyone explain to me why oh why can't I join Arcs into existing polylines (AutoCAD LT 2015)?

Join & Fillet are both toothless in this instance.

 

Thank you for any explanations; file attached.

BTW: 

Your geometry resides far away from the origin point. This causes the problem.
